高二英語假期自主學(xué)習(xí)總結(jié)

假期自主學(xué)習(xí)總結(jié)高二英語備課組

201*-3-7

一、好處:

1.對老師的好處:a.督促老師必需把握學(xué)情,并依據(jù)學(xué)情設(shè)計(jì)學(xué)案,這樣學(xué)案才能保證使用效果。b.拓寬了老師的教學(xué)思路,為新學(xué)期教學(xué)方法的調(diào)整做了鋪墊,由于老師依據(jù)假期自主學(xué)習(xí)比拼的狀況能夠發(fā)覺同學(xué)的優(yōu)點(diǎn)和學(xué)習(xí)上遇到的障礙。廢除了以往假期作業(yè)的盲目性和同學(xué)的應(yīng)付狀況。c.開學(xué)后節(jié)約了不少珍貴的課時(shí)。便利了老師有正對性的進(jìn)行大膽取舍。

2.對同學(xué)的好處:a.同學(xué)的學(xué)習(xí)潛能得到了極大的開發(fā),有些學(xué)習(xí)相對較弱的同學(xué)利用假期時(shí)間,依據(jù)學(xué)案內(nèi)容,對基礎(chǔ)學(xué)問特殊是詞匯進(jìn)行了一個(gè)大補(bǔ)習(xí),快速的趕上期其他同學(xué)。每個(gè)班都有這樣的同學(xué),比如六班的張猛同學(xué),經(jīng)過假期,詞匯扎實(shí)了很多,樂觀性上來了,成果明顯有了進(jìn)步。當(dāng)然閱讀和理解的差距趕上來還需要些時(shí)日。b.各班都涌現(xiàn)了自主學(xué)習(xí)的樂觀分子,他們遇到問題,先樂觀想方法自己查閱資料,仍無法解決的主動(dòng)向老師求教。這次比拼難度不小,但我們最高分94,90分以上的同學(xué)不下10人,這還是比較抱負(fù)的。c.同學(xué)自主學(xué)習(xí)、自我管理的力量得到了有效提升。

3.加強(qiáng)了老師與家長之間的溝通。本次假期自主學(xué)習(xí)成果比較抱負(fù),這要得益于放假前老師們的仔細(xì)備課、同學(xué)家長會(huì)上對家長和同學(xué)進(jìn)行的方法指導(dǎo),使我們老師的設(shè)計(jì)初衷能夠零距離傳達(dá)到家長。假期中仍有家長與老師溝通孩子的學(xué)習(xí)狀況,特別支持老師的工作,關(guān)注同學(xué)的成果。二、與預(yù)期結(jié)果的不同:

1.尖子生的成果比預(yù)想的要突出。但班級平均分與預(yù)想有差距。由于,班級平均分必需有全部同學(xué)樂觀參加假期自主學(xué)習(xí)做保障。這次重點(diǎn)班、文科班總體表現(xiàn)很好,3、4班有超過三分之一的同學(xué)假期自主學(xué)習(xí)基本沒有落實(shí),成果很不抱負(fù),四非常左右的同學(xué)還有二十幾名。

2.比拼試題中含有聽力,一個(gè)假期沒有聽了,仍有同學(xué)表現(xiàn)精彩,超出預(yù)想。但大部分同學(xué)聽力明顯較放假前有了退步。開學(xué)后要立刻試聽練耳。

3.各班有效落實(shí)自主學(xué)習(xí)的同學(xué)數(shù)量有了明顯提升。第一次自主學(xué)習(xí)時(shí),參加的同學(xué)還是許多的。但到了其次次,參加數(shù)量明顯有了下降,原來想這次會(huì)不會(huì)連續(xù)下降呢?但觀看結(jié)果,發(fā)覺本次仔細(xì)參加的同學(xué)遠(yuǎn)遠(yuǎn)高過其次次的,甚至超過了第一次仔細(xì)參加的同學(xué)。四、發(fā)覺了什么問題?

1.各班都有沒仔細(xì)落實(shí)的同學(xué),比如這次六班的劉星宇、李鴻基、楊一凡、劉昊和羅一京幾位同學(xué)假期自主學(xué)習(xí)落實(shí)得就不是很好,從本次的測試中他們的成果分別是58,62,75和59,和67,六班的平均分是78分,他們在成果上的確是班里的最終幾名。對于這部分同學(xué),真剛要落實(shí)的不是學(xué)問而是態(tài)度。2.一般班同學(xué)自主學(xué)習(xí)落實(shí)效果不抱負(fù)。女生能有2/3做了,男生仔細(xì)做的同學(xué)也就是1/2。自主學(xué)習(xí)任務(wù)目前沒有在這些同學(xué)身上實(shí)現(xiàn)。五、今后在自主學(xué)習(xí)的設(shè)計(jì)中需要有什么改進(jìn)?

1.可以在重點(diǎn)題目后加入解析。

2.對于學(xué)困生的任務(wù)再進(jìn)行分層優(yōu)化,便于他們的操作。3.適當(dāng)增加小組合作的實(shí)踐操作性任務(wù),提升同學(xué)的學(xué)習(xí)愛好。
